CVE-2019-13946 |
Profinet-IO (PNIO) stack versions prior V06.00 do not properly limit internal resource allocation when multiple legitimate diagnostic package requests are sent to the DCE-RPC interface. This could lead to a denial of service condition due to lack of memory for devices that include a vulnerable version of the stack. The security vulnerability could be exploited by an attacker with network access to an affected device. Successful exploitation requires no system privileges and no user interaction. An attacker could use the vulnerability to compromise the availability of the device. Published: February 11, 2020; 11:15:15 AM -0500 |
V4.0:(not available) V3.x:(not available) V2.0: 7.8 HIGH |

CVE-2017-2681 |
Specially crafted PROFINET DCP packets sent on a local Ethernet segment (Layer 2) to an affected product could cause a denial of service condition of that product. Human interaction is required to recover the system. PROFIBUS interfaces are not affected. Published: May 11, 2017; 6:29:00 AM -0400 |
V4.0:(not available) V3.1: 6.5 MEDIUM V2.0: 6.1 MEDIUM |
